San Dimas is a tranquil city in Los Angeles County, California, known for its laid-back lifestyle and natural beauty. With stunning views of the San Gabriel Mountains, it's an ideal escape from urban hustle. The city boasts numerous parks and hiking trails, perfect for outdoor enthusiasts. San Dimas is also famous for its community events and festivals, showcasing rich local culture.
Must-see attractions in San Dimas include the San Dimas Canyon Nature Center, offering educational resources and hiking trails. Frank G. Bonelli Regional Park is a great spot for picnics, fishing, and water activities. The San Dimas Historical Museum provides insights into the city's development and culture.
San Dimas offers a blend of culinary flavors, with must-try dishes like Mexican tacos and American burgers. Family-owned eateries serve authentic Californian cuisine. Don't miss local artisanal ice cream shops for freshly made treats.
Transportation in San Dimas relies mainly on private cars, but buses and ride-sharing are also available. The city's wide roads make driving convenient. Use apps like Google Maps or Waze to avoid traffic. For trips to downtown LA, the Metrolink commuter train takes about an hour.
The best times to visit are spring (March-May) and fall (September-November), with mild weather ideal for outdoor activities. Summers are hot but great for water activities. Winters are quieter, perfect for those seeking peace.
The official language is English, but Spanish is widely spoken. Wi-Fi is readily available in cafes and restaurants. Credit cards are preferred, but carry some cash. For emergencies, dial 911. Medical facilities are robust, with Pomona Valley Hospital Medical Center nearby. The voltage is 120V, with Type A/B outlets; bring an adapter if needed.
